LivagenvsVentfort

Tetrapeptide bioregulator (Lys-Glu-Asp-Ala) that directly penetrates cell nuclei and binds double-stranded DNA to induce chromatin decondensation in senescent lymphocytes, activate ribosomal genes, inhibit enkephalin-degrading enzymes with an IC50 of 20 μM, and restore protein synthesis capacity in aging cells through selective epigenetic remodeling

Vascular peptide bioregulator complex derived from bovine aorta containing ultrashort peptides (including KED sequence) that normalize vascular endothelial function, reduce total cholesterol by up to 30% in clinical studies, and restore arterial elasticity through epigenetic regulation of extracellular matrix remodeling genes in aging blood vessels
